FAQ
- What is Conagra Brands's average annual return?
- Since 1981, Conagra Brands (CAG) has returned about 10.3% a year (the compound annual growth rate) and an average calendar-year return of 11.5%.
- What were Conagra Brands's best and worst years?
- Over 1981–2026, the best year was 2019 (+65.5%) and the worst was 2018 (-42.0%).
- How often is Conagra Brands up in a year?
- 30 of the 45 full years since 1981 were positive — about 67% of the time.
